Description
A newsflash clipping describing Korean War encounter of USS Manchester (CL-83), during which the ship fired its 50,000th round of ammunition. The reverse is a section of an article discussing Communist prisoners of war. Handwritten note reads: "from ships paper at sea". Date approximated.
